Watchdog: Air Force May Spend $300M Per Jet for Next-Gen Fighter Fleet
Government Technology/News
Watchdog: Air Force May Spend $300M Per Jet for Next-Gen Fighter Fleet

A new report by the Congressional Budget Office predicts the U.S. Air Force might spend nearly $300M per aircraft for a new fleet of next-generation air superiority jets, Defense News reported Saturday.
